Lot Details
CHAGALL, MARC
1887 Vitebsk - 1985 St. Paul de Vence

Title: Das Lied der Lieder.
Date: 1975.
Technique: Colour lithograph on Arches vellum (watermark).
Depiction Size: 52 x 43cm.
Sheet Size: 70,5 x 53,5cm.
Notation: Signed and numbered.
Publisher: Association of Friends of the National Museum of Biblical Message Marc Chagall, Nice (publisher).
Number: 47/200.
Frame/Pedestal: Framed.


In the stone on the lower left is the typographical inscription: CH. Sorlier Grav.Lith. The lithograph was printed by Mourlot, Paris.

The work is based on the left part of a study for the painting "Song of Songs III", created in 1960. The motif was also used as a billboard for the National Museum in Japan. This work is a print of the edition without letters, which was published in a limited edition of 200 copies.

Provenance:
- Private collection North Rhine-Westphalia

Literature:
- Sorlier, Charles: Chagall - Lithograph V, 1974-1979, Monte-Carlo 1984, cat. rais. no. CS 47, ill.
- Sorlier, Charles: Die Plakate von Marc Chagall, Geneva 1975, p. 150f.
